Description
Fuji Koro sends samurai warriors tumbling into a huge cavern beneath an erupting volcano where they must explore ruined temples fight dragons and gather sacred relics before escaping with treasure for the Shogun.

Mechanics (from transcript analysis)
- Action disk placement — Players place action disks to indicate two actions per turn, with four action types: Move, Explore, Gather, Rest.
- Card Crafting — Craft helmet, weapon, or sandals by paying resources and meet gear constraints to gain bonuses.
- Crafting gear — Craft helmet, weapon, or sandals by paying resources and meet gear constraints to gain bonuses.
- Dragon combat — Dragons provide combat encounters. Combat uses dice based on gear and blueprints; multiple players can join in on a dragon.
- Endgame scoring and palace exit — Players score for tokens placed on tracks in the Big Palace or Small Palace and at final scoring after escaping.
- Monks and temples — Monk tokens unlock new areas and bonuses, including additional actions and slots for scrolls, blueprints, and gear.
- Resource Management — Collect resources, sacred scrolls, monks, and blueprints to craft gear and score points.
- Tile exploration — Explore volcano by placing tiles adjacent to explored areas and resolving level-based rewards.
- Volcano eruption endgame — When a player reaches 30 points, a countdown triggers; lava tiles appear and a rope exit may allow escape to score.
